Emirates Airline said on Friday that it is willing to consider picking up a stake in an airline in India if the Government relaxes investment norms for foreign airlines.

`Open-minded'

"Emirates is open minded on acquisition opportunities," Mr Nabil Sultan,Emirates Airline Senior Vice-President for Commercial Operations, West Asia & Indian Ocean, told presspersons.

"As and when opportunities arises, we will take appropriate business decision," he said.

Emirates has a code share agreement with Jet Airways and has a joint venture with Sri Lankan.

He said the current fares of Emirates are at least 20 per cent lesser than what they were a year ago. Over the last one year, the airline has also added 6,000 seats from India, he added.
